Technical SEO & SiteCrawling Tools While all-in-one suites use fundamental auditing, complex enterprise websites need"deep-sea"scuba divers. Technical SEO toolsare designed to crawl thousands-- or millions-- of pages to discover damaged links,replicate material &, and indexing problems that
would otherwise go undetected. Specialized Crawlers Screaming Frog SEO Spider: A desktop-based program that excels at identifying granular technical mistakes. It is vital for checking status codes, meta-data, and website architecture. Sitebulb: This tool provides a highly visual method to auditing, providing"prioritized tips"that help agency staff describe technical issues to non-technical clients. Botify/Deepcrawl(Lumar): These are enterprise-level, cloud-based spiders capable of handling massive e-commerce sites with countless URLs. 3. Often Asked Questions(FAQ)What is the single crucial tool for an SEO agency? While it dependson the agency's focus, Google Search Console is arguably the most essential because it supplies first-party information directly from Google relating to indexing, manual actions, and actual search inquiries. Just how much should an agency invest on their toolkit? Early-stage agencies may invest between ₤ 300 and ₤ 500 per month.
Mid-to-large scale firms with multiple seats and high API use can easily spend ₤ 2,000 to₤ 5,000 monthly on a thorough stack. Should I select Semrush or Ahrefs? Both are excellent. Semrushis usually better for agencies that likewise manage PPC and social networks, whereas Ahrefs is frequently preferred by technical SEOs and link-building specialists due to its exceptional backlink index. Can I run an SEO agencyusing just free tools? It is possible to start an agency with free tools like Google Search Console, Analytics, and different Chrome extensions.Nevertheless, scaling becomes difficult due to the fact that free tools lack the automation, bulk processing, and professional reporting functions needed to handle multiple clients effectively. Are AI writing tools safe for customer work? AI writing tools are safe as long as they are utilized for brainstorming, outlining, and drafting.
Agencies must constantly have a human editor review and fact-check AI-generated content to ensure it satisfies Google's" E-E-A-T"(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ness )requirements.
